Purpose of this Position: This role involves producing accurate, competitive, and low-risk estimates and drafting proposals for active construction bids using Colony's established tools and procedures.

Responsibilities:

  • Attend client meetings as required pre-bid or post-bid (virtually or in-person).
  • Review tender drawings and specifications in detail. Develop RFIs for the Proposal Sales Manager (PSM) or Chief Estimator (CE) to issue to the client.
  • Read proposed Prime Contract terms and conditions. Flag any terms that Colony should be aware of prior to submitting the proposal.
  • Choose major subcontractors and suppliers for each project. Draft scopes of work and create detailed RFQs. Call, email, follow-up, and field questions where necessary.
  • Enter building designs into pre-engineered manufacturer's pricing software and run Simple Trade Off thermal calculations for wall and roof systems when required.
  • Obtain multiple prices for scopes requiring competitive pricing and/or risk mitigation.
  • Maintain Colony proposal folders in an orderly fashion and in accordance with Colony file-saving procedures.
  • Create competitive advantages for Colony through innovative thinking and value engineering.
  • Prepare estimates, draft proposals, construction schedules, execution plans, safety documents, and other technical customer-requested bid forms.
  • Organize estimates into logical cost codes.
  • Present all proposal documents to PSM and CE in final estimate review meetings prior to submittal.
  • Maintain a database of budgetary unit prices for all scopes and divisions to be used as plug numbers when required.
  • Prepare for and attend Project Handover Meetings. Ensure any non-standard vendor payment terms are flagged for discussion and that all prices are valid for a minimum of 2 weeks after the date of handover.
  • Support Project Managers in interpreting estimates during the project execution phase. Estimate substantial changes in scope for projects during execution.
  • Develop and maintain win-win relationships with vendors. Understand who is best suited for what type of work in a particular region.
  • Provide feedback to vendors to help improve future bids while maintaining high ethical standards.
  • Maintain the Colony trade/vendor database, adding new trades/vendors and updating information as needed.
  • Protect Colony's interests both legally and financially against suppliers, subcontractors, and clients.
